Raclette Dinner Swiss Melted Cheese (Printable)

Festive Swiss meal with melted cheese served with potatoes, vegetables, and accompaniments for warm gatherings.

# What You'll Need:

→ Cheeses

01 - 1.75 pounds raclette cheese, sliced

→ Vegetables

02 - 1.75 pounds small waxy potatoes
03 - 1 red bell pepper, sliced
04 - 1 yellow bell pepper, sliced
05 - 1 zucchini, sliced
06 - 3.5 ounces button mushrooms, sliced
07 - 1 red onion, thinly sliced
08 - 1 small jar (about 7 ounces) cornichons or gherkins
09 - 1 small jar (about 3.5 ounces) pickled pearl onions

→ Charcuterie

10 - 5.5 ounces prosciutto
11 - 5.5 ounces salami
12 - 5.5 ounces smoked ham

→ Condiments

13 - Freshly ground black pepper
14 - Paprika
15 - Dry or fresh herbs (thyme, chives, parsley)

# Directions:

01 - Scrub the potatoes thoroughly and place in a saucepan with salted water. Bring to a boil and cook until tender when pierced with a fork, approximately 15-20 minutes. Drain well and keep warm.
02 - Organize the boiled potatoes, sliced bell peppers, zucchini, mushrooms, red onion, cornichons, and pickled onions on serving platters. Add charcuterie if desired.
03 - Set up and preheat the raclette grill according to the manufacturer's instructions, ensuring it reaches the proper melting temperature.
04 - Each guest places their choice of sliced vegetables or charcuterie into an individual raclette pan, tops with a slice of raclette cheese, and places it under the heating element. Melt for 5-8 minutes until bubbly and golden brown.
05 - Spoon the melted cheese and contents over warm potatoes. Season with black pepper, paprika, and fresh herbs to taste. Continue with additional combinations throughout the meal.

# Expert Tips:

01 -
  • The interactive nature turns dinner into an event where everyone participates and creates their own perfect bites
  • It's incredibly forgiving since guests customize everything, so you can actually relax and enjoy your own party
02 -
  • Don't slice your cheese too thick or it won't melt properly in those little pans
  • Keep the potatoes warm throughout the meal since cold cheese on cold potatoes is just sad
03 -
  • Have extra cheese on hand because it always disappears faster than you expect
